| int |
| _PyLexer_set_ftstring_expr(struct tok_state* tok, struct token *token, char c) { |
| assert(token != NULL); |
| assert(c == '}' || c == ':' || c == '!'); |
| tokenizer_mode *tok_mode = TOK_GET_MODE(tok); |
| |
| if (!(tok_mode->in_debug || tok_mode->string_kind == TSTRING) || token->metadata) { |
| return 0; |
| } |
| PyObject *res = NULL; |
| |
| // Look for a # character outside of string literals |
| int hash_detected = 0; |
| int in_string = 0; |
| char quote_char = 0; |
| |
| for (Py_ssize_t i = 0; i < tok_mode->last_expr_size - tok_mode->last_expr_end; i++) { |
| char ch = tok_mode->last_expr_buffer[i]; |
| |
| // Skip escaped characters |
| if (ch == '\\') { |
| i++; |
| continue; |
| } |
| |
| // Handle quotes |
| if (ch == '"' || ch == '\'') { |
| // The following if/else block works becase there is an off number |
| // of quotes in STRING tokens and the lexer only ever reaches this |
| // function with valid STRING tokens. |
| // For example: """hello""" |
| // First quote: in_string = 1 |
| // Second quote: in_string = 0 |
| // Third quote: in_string = 1 |
| if (!in_string) { |
| in_string = 1; |
| quote_char = ch; |
| } |
| else if (ch == quote_char) { |
| in_string = 0; |
| } |
| continue; |
| } |
| |
| // Check for # outside strings |
| if (ch == '#' && !in_string) { |
| hash_detected = 1; |
| break; |
| } |
| } |
| // If we found a # character in the expression, we need to handle comments |
| if (hash_detected) { |
| // Allocate buffer for processed result |
| char *result = (char *)PyMem_Malloc((tok_mode->last_expr_size - tok_mode->last_expr_end + 1) * sizeof(char)); |
| if (!result) { |
| return -1; |
| } |
| |
| Py_ssize_t i = 0; // Input position |
| Py_ssize_t j = 0; // Output position |
| in_string = 0; // Whether we're in a string |
| quote_char = 0; // Current string quote char |
| |
| // Process each character |
| while (i < tok_mode->last_expr_size - tok_mode->last_expr_end) { |
| char ch = tok_mode->last_expr_buffer[i]; |
| |
| // Handle string quotes |
| if (ch == '"' || ch == '\'') { |
| // See comment above to understand this part |
| if (!in_string) { |
| in_string = 1; |
| quote_char = ch; |
| } else if (ch == quote_char) { |
| in_string = 0; |
| } |
| result[j++] = ch; |
| } |
| // Skip comments |
| else if (ch == '#' && !in_string) { |
| while (i < tok_mode->last_expr_size - tok_mode->last_expr_end && |
| tok_mode->last_expr_buffer[i] != '\n') { |
| i++; |
| } |
| if (i < tok_mode->last_expr_size - tok_mode->last_expr_end) { |
| result[j++] = '\n'; |
| } |
| } |
| // Copy other chars |
| else { |
| result[j++] = ch; |
| } |
| i++; |
| } |
| |
| result[j] = '\0'; // Null-terminate the result string |
| res = PyUnicode_DecodeUTF8(result, j, NULL); |
| PyMem_Free(result); |
| } else { |
| res = PyUnicode_DecodeUTF8( |
| tok_mode->last_expr_buffer, |
| tok_mode->last_expr_size - tok_mode->last_expr_end, |
| NULL |
| ); |
| } |
| |
| if (!res) { |
| return -1; |
| } |
| token->metadata = res; |
| return 0; |
| } |

| int |
| _PyLexer_check_string_prefixes(struct tok_state *tok, |
| int saw_b, int saw_r, int saw_u, |
| int saw_f, int saw_t) { |
| // Supported: rb, rf, rt (in any order) |
| // Unsupported: ub, ur, uf, ut, bf, bt, ft (in any order) |
| |
| #define R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R(PREFIX1, PREFIX2) \ |
| do { \ |
| (void)_PyTokenizer_syntaxerror_known_range( \ |
| tok, (int)(tok->start + 1 - tok->line_start), \ |
| (int)(tok->cur - tok->line_start), \ |
| "'" PREFIX1 "' and '" PREFIX2 "' prefixes are incompatible"); \ |
| return -1; \ |
| } while (0) |
| |
| if (saw_u && saw_b) { |
| R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R("u", "b"); |
| } |
| if (saw_u && saw_r) { |
| R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R("u", "r"); |
| } |
| if (saw_u && saw_f) { |
| R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R("u", "f"); |
| } |
| if (saw_u && saw_t) { |
| R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R("u", "t"); |
| } |
| |
| if (saw_b && saw_f) { |
| R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R("b", "f"); |
| } |
| if (saw_b && saw_t) { |
| R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R("b", "t"); |
| } |
| |
| if (saw_f && saw_t) { |
| R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R("f", "t"); |
| } |
| |
| #undef RETURN_SYNTAX_ERROR |
| |
| return 0; |
| } |

| int |
| _PyLexer_scan_string(struct tok_state *tok, struct token *token, int c) |
| { |
| const char *p_start = NULL; |
| const char *p_end = NULL; |
| |
| int quote = c; |
| int quote_size = 1; /* 1 or 3 */ |
| int end_quote_size = 0; |
| int has_escaped_quote = 0; |
| |
| /* Nodes of type STRING, especially multi line strings |
| must be handled differently in order to get both |
| the starting line number and the column offset right. |
| (cf. issue 16806) */ |
| tok->first_lineno = tok->lineno; |
| tok->multi_line_start = tok->line_start; |
| |
| /* Find the quote size and start of string */ |
| c = tok_nextc(tok); |
| if (c == quote) { |
| c = tok_nextc(tok); |
| if (c == quote) { |
| quote_size = 3; |
| } |
| else { |
| end_quote_size = 1; /* empty string found */ |
| } |
| } |
| if (c != quote) { |
| tok_backup(tok, c); |
| } |
| |
| /* Get rest of string */ |
| while (end_quote_size != quote_size) { |
| c = tok_nextc(tok); |
| if (tok->done == E_ERROR) { |
| return MAKE_TOKEN(ERRORTOKEN); |
| } |
| if (tok->done == E_DECODE) { |
| break; |
| } |
| if (c == EOF || (quote_size == 1 && c == '\n')) { |
| assert(tok->multi_line_start != NULL); |
| // shift the tok_state's location into |
| // the start of string, and report the error |
| // from the initial quote character |
| tok->cur = (char *)tok->start; |
| tok->cur++; |
| tok->line_start = tok->multi_line_start; |
| int start = tok->lineno; |
| tok->lineno = tok->first_lineno; |
| |
| if (INSIDE_FSTRING(tok)) { |
| /* When we are in an f-string, before raising the |
| * unterminated string literal error, check whether |
| * does the initial quote matches with f-strings quotes |
| * and if it is, then this must be a missing '}' token |
| * so raise the proper error */ |
| tokenizer_mode *the_current_tok = TOK_GET_MODE(tok); |
| if (the_current_tok->quote == quote && |
| the_current_tok->quote_size == quote_size) { |
| return MAKE_TOKEN(_PyTokenizer_syntaxerror(tok, |
| "%c-string: expecting '}'", TOK_GET_STRING_PREFIX(tok))); |
| } |
| } |
| |
| if (quote_size == 3) { |
| _PyTokenizer_syntaxerror(tok, "unterminated triple-quoted string literal" |
| " (detected at line %d)", start); |
| if (c != '\n') { |
| tok->done = E_EOFS; |
| } |
| return MAKE_TOKEN(ERRORTOKEN); |
| } |
| else { |
| if (has_escaped_quote) { |
| _PyTokenizer_syntaxerror( |
| tok, |
| "unterminated string literal (detected at line %d); " |
| "perhaps you escaped the end quote?", |
| start |
| ); |
| } else { |
| _PyTokenizer_syntaxerror( |
| tok, "unterminated string literal (detected at line %d)", start |
| ); |
| } |
| if (c != '\n') { |
| tok->done = E_EOLS; |
| } |
| return MAKE_TOKEN(ERRORTOKEN); |
| } |
| } |
| if (c == quote) { |
| end_quote_size += 1; |
| } |
| else { |
| end_quote_size = 0; |
| if (c == '\\') { |
| c = tok_nextc(tok); /* skip escaped char */ |
| if (c == quote) { /* but record whether the escaped char was a quote */ |
| has_escaped_quote = 1; |
| } |
| if (c == '\r') { |
| c = tok_nextc(tok); |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| |
| p_start = tok->start; |
| p_end = tok->cur; |
| return MAKE_TOKEN(STRING); |
| } |
